Second Stage Round 8: OSE Lions - Kaposvari 101-73
Date: May 4, 2022
The game had a very big importance for third-ranked OSE Lions as it allowed them to take a leadership position. OSE Lions smashed second-ranked Kaposvari in Oraszlany 101-73. It was a key game for the top position in the league. OSE Lions made 21-of-26 free shots (80.8 percent) during the game. OSE Lions outrebounded Kaposvari 44-27 including a 31-20 advantage in defensive rebounds. 27 personal fouls committed by Kaposvari helped opponents get some easy free throw opportunities. Worth to mention a great performance of Slovenian swingman Blaz Mesicek (197-1997, agency: Octagon Europe) who helped to win the game recording 25 points and 6 rebounds and American guard Omar Calhoun (198-1993, college: UConn) who added 21 points and 9 rebounds during the contest. American guard TJ Price (193-1993, college: WKU, agency: Slash Sports) responded with 21 points and 6 assists and his fellow American import forward Wayne Martin (201-1993, college: Tennessee St., agency: Octagon Europe) produced a double-double by scoring 11 points and 10 rebounds. Five OSE Lions and four Kaposvari players scored in double figures. The winner was already known earlier in the game, so both coaches allowed to play the bench players saving starting five for next games. OSE Lions have a solid four-game winning streak. As mentioned above they are at the top of the standings, which they share with Sopron KC and Duna Aszfalt. Kaposvari at the other side dropped to the third place with 16 games lost. They share the position with Szedeak. Kaposvari will play next round against strong Duna Aszfalt trying to get back on the winning streak. OSE Lions will have a break next round, and it should allow them to practice more before next game.
